Bionic ears replace the user's [[Table of Human Body Parts|organic ear]]. They are universal and can be installed on either the left or right side. It has a part efficiency of 125%, which impacts [[Hearing]]. It also removes the "''Disfigured''" [[social|opinion penalty]] from other pawns when missing an ear.
  
The more capable ear is responsible for 75% of Hearing. For pawn with 2 healthy ears, installing a 1 bionic ear increases hearing by 19%.
